Koan-Sin Tan 369e2d8f5d make bazel build work on aarch64/arm linux
make
```
bazel build //tensorflow/tools/pip_package:build_pip_package
````
work again on aarch64 (e.g., EdgeTPU Dev board and Jetson boards)
and arm (e.g, Raspberry Pi 3/4 boards) Linux platforms

without this patch, I saw

```
...
ERROR: While resolving toolchains for target //tensorflow:libtensorflow_framework.so.2.1.0: No matching toolchains found for types @bazel_tools//tools/cpp:toolchain_type. Maybe --incompatible_use_cc_configure_from_rules_cc has been flipped and there is no default C++ toolchain added in the WORKSPACE file? See https://github.com/bazelbuild/bazel/issues/10134 for details and migration instructions.
ERROR: Analysis of target '//tensorflow/tools/pip_package:build_pip_package' failed; build aborted: No matching toolchains found for types @bazel_tools//tools/cpp:toolchain_type. Maybe --incompatible_use_cc_configure_from_rules_cc has been flipped and there is no default C++ toolchain added in the WORKSPACE file? See https://github.com/bazelbuild/bazel/issues/10134 for details and migration instructions.
```

"""Repository rule to create a platform for a docker image to be used with RBE."""
def _remote_platform_configure_impl(repository_ctx):
platform = repository_ctx.attr.platform
if platform == "local":
os = repository_ctx.os.name.lower()
if os.startswith("windows"):
platform = "windows"
elif os.startswith("mac os"):
platform = "osx"
else:
platform = "linux"
cpu = "x86_64"
machine_type = repository_ctx.execute(["bash", "-c", "echo $MACHTYPE"]).stdout
if (machine_type.startswith("ppc") or
machine_type.startswith("powerpc")):
cpu = "ppc"
elif machine_type.startswith("s390x"):
cpu = "s390x"
elif machine_type.startswith("aarch64"):
cpu = "aarch64"
elif machine_type.startswith("arm"):
cpu = "arm"
exec_properties = repository_ctx.attr.platform_exec_properties
serialized_exec_properties = "{"
for k, v in exec_properties.items():
serialized_exec_properties += "\"%s\" : \"%s\"," % (k, v)
serialized_exec_properties += "}"
repository_ctx.template(
"BUILD",
Label("@org_tensorflow//third_party/remote_config:BUILD.tpl"),
{
"%{platform}": platform,
"%{exec_properties}": serialized_exec_properties,
"%{cpu}": cpu,
},
)
remote_platform_configure = repository_rule(
implementation = _remote_platform_configure_impl,
attrs = {
"platform_exec_properties": attr.string_dict(mandatory = True),
"platform": attr.string(default = "linux", values = ["linux", "windows", "local"]),
},
)
